City police arrested 6 suspects in a Baltimore district raid near Odonnell Heights Friday morning.
Police said around 4:30 a.m. detectives from the Southeast District Operations executed two seizure and search warrants at a home located in the 6100 block of Shipview way.
During the raid, detectives found drugs, money and several guns including a reported stolen semi-automatic handgun.
According to police, all of the property seized was turned in as evidence and the following people were arrested:

The six suspects were taken to Central Booking and have been charged with narcotic trafficking and several handgun violations.
